I can see both pics when I log in.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;As to retrieve, a simple twitch twitch, pause, twitch, let it sink ....repeat works pretty well for me. When sightfishing, pull the lure away from the fish and if the fish shows interest, pick-up the speed to intice the strike. The flash from the twitch really gets the hit because it seems like the lure is injured, so remember to present it in a way that imitates a wounded baitfish.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I purchased my Mirrodines at Cook's Sportland in Venice but check and ask your local tackle stores to see if they can order them for you. ;)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Dick's and Bass Pro may also have them in stock but if they are very new, perhaps not? &l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Remember......., "Every Fishing Season starts at Dick's!" I have been waiting for Mirrolure to come out with this lure in a gold sided plug for off-colored water. Now they have! Guess my e-mail worked! :)&lt;P&gt;The colors I found that have the gold foil sides so far (gold relective foil inserts) are the 17MRG (Clear with Gold Foil) and the 17MR19 (Green Back, Gold Foil, Yellow Belly, Red Chin). There may be additional ones but so far, these are the ones I've seen. &l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I bet the fish will tear these lures up in dingy water! The reds should just crush these gold sided plugs.
